Speed Restrictions and Slower Journeys Become the New Normal
Publicly available information from rail operators and travel advisories shows that high temperatures are forcing widespread speed limits on key passenger routes across Western and Central Europe. When steel rails heat and expand, they can buckle out of alignment, so infrastructure managers are cutting maximum speeds during the hottest hours of the day. That precaution is lengthening journey times on busy intercity and commuter corridors just as holiday traffic builds.
Network advisories in the United Kingdom, Belgium and parts of Germany indicate that trains which normally run at full line speed are being held to significantly lower limits on exposed sections of track. Passengers are being told to expect fewer services, extended travel times and short-notice service alterations as control centers respond to real-time temperature readings and track inspections.
Travel updates shared by pan-European rail booking platforms also point to a pattern of “yellow” and “red” disruption alerts tied directly to the heat. These alerts flag delays and partial cancellations on cross-border routes linking France, the Benelux countries and western Germany, particularly in the afternoon windows when track temperatures are highest.
Targeted Cancellations Hit France, Belgium and Cross-Channel Links
The most visible rail impact so far has been a wave of targeted cancellations on long-distance and international services. In France, industry coverage reports that SNCF has pre-emptively cancelled dozens of Intercités trains on routes such as Paris to Clermont-Ferrand, Paris to Orléans, Limoges and Toulouse, and Bordeaux to Marseille during the peak of the heat. The operator is concentrating cuts in the middle of the day, when both infrastructure stress and onboard cooling demands are highest.
Belgium’s national operator has reduced peak-hour commuter services, with several P-trains suspended on key approaches into Brussels. Travel advisories describe a focus on maintaining a core timetable while trimming extra peak services that put additional strain on already stressed infrastructure.
Internationally, some cross-Channel trains between Paris and London have also been withdrawn or rescheduled. According to recent travel and business press coverage, Eurostar has cancelled selected departures and warned of potential knock-on delays, citing the combined impact of high temperatures on infrastructure and rolling stock. The company is offering flexible rebooking to affected passengers, a measure mirrored by several national carriers on the continent.
Local Disruption Spreads to Regional and Commuter Lines
The disruption is not limited to headline high-speed routes. Regional and commuter lines in the United Kingdom, France, Germany and the Low Countries are also reporting timetable changes linked to the heatwave. Public information from British regional operators in the Midlands and north of England, for example, points to “significantly reduced” weekday services and advisories against nonessential travel during the hottest days.
In smaller networks across Central Europe, speed reductions have been introduced on lightly built secondary lines where track structures are more vulnerable to thermal stress. In Slovenia and parts of Austria and southern Germany, rail companies have announced daytime speed caps on certain routes, particularly on lines with older infrastructure or tight curves that are more sensitive to track distortion.
These changes are rippling through to international itineraries used by visitors with rail passes. European rail planning sites are warning that some regional connections feeding into high-speed hubs may run less frequently or at altered times, making previously straightforward same-day connections more precarious for travelers.
Tourists Face Altered Itineraries and Packed Replacement Services
For leisure travelers, the timing of the heatwave during the early summer getaway period is amplifying the impact. Travel media reports describe passengers re-routing trips to avoid the hottest afternoon departures, shifting to early-morning or late-evening trains that are now becoming heavily booked. In some cases, replacement buses are being used on sections where rail speeds have been cut to unsustainable levels, adding road congestion and extending overall travel times.
Travel advisories aimed at visitors stress the importance of checking train status on the day of travel, building extra time for connections and preparing for warmer-than-usual conditions at stations and on board. Older trains and crowded commuter sets may struggle to maintain comfortable interior temperatures, particularly when long delays mean air-conditioning systems run at full power for extended periods.
Accommodation providers in major hubs such as Paris, Brussels and London are also beginning to report last-minute changes as rail passengers adjust plans. Some travelers are choosing to stay additional nights rather than risk tight onward connections, while others are abandoning rail segments in favor of last-minute car rentals or short-haul flights where those remain available.
Heatwave Underscores Climate Resilience Gaps in European Rail
The current disruption is highlighting the challenge of adapting Europe’s vast rail network to a climate in which episodes of extreme heat are becoming more frequent. Analysis published by climate and transport specialists notes that much of the continent’s infrastructure was designed for historic temperature ranges that no longer reflect present-day conditions. Rails, overhead power lines and signaling systems are all under stress during prolonged hot spells.
Recent reporting on a new assessment by the EU Agency for Railways points to heat, alongside flooding and landslides, as a growing operational threat. The agency has urged stronger standards for climate resilience in new construction and upgrades, including revised temperature thresholds for track materials, more extensive real-time monitoring systems and operational rules that balance safety with service continuity in extreme weather.
National rail companies are experimenting with measures such as painting rails in lighter colors on particularly exposed stretches, installing additional track sensors and expanding preventive maintenance during summer months. Even so, technical specialists quoted in European media coverage suggest that such solutions are expensive to deploy at scale and will take years to roll out comprehensively across the continent’s dense rail grids.
For now, rail passengers across Europe face an increasingly familiar summer scenario: slower trains, altered timetables and the possibility of sudden cancellations whenever temperatures spike. As the current heatwave continues, travel planners expect rail disruption to remain a significant factor for anyone crossing the continent by train in the days ahead.
